What they do
A Logistics Specialist plans and manages logistics, including the distribution and transportation of supplies, equipment or materials for a company or organization. Develops order schedules and policies, tracks shipments, coordinates storage and works with suppliers and transportation companies. Implements efficient and cost-effective transportation and distribution systems.

The MRAP Transportation & Movement Support supportsACC/A4RM
in executing tactical and strategic logistics, maintenance planning, configuration management, technical analysis, policy, procedural development, Concepts of Operation (CONOPS), and program management support for the MRAP weapon system. Responsibilities & Objectives of thisRole:
Coordinate transportation arrangements with the losing/gaining field level units. Generate movement memorandums for government review and release. Provide official memorandum and historical documentation on the movement of MRAP Platforms and associated MSE to and from depot and integration facilities and from integration facilities to final beddown location as directed by theMRAP SSM
Program Manager. Track movement status and inform gaining unit of departure, estimated arrival, and reception instructions. Obtain access to transportation tracking systems (United States Transportation Command (USTRANSCOM) Global Transportation Network, and electronic Transportation Acquisition, etc.) that provide in transit visibility of directed shipments to final destination. Work closely with units to ensure platform inspections are conducted and accurate prior to each MRAP movement. Submit requests to theMRAP SSM
for the use of their Transportation Account Code (TAC) for movements of MRAPs, MSE, Controlled Cryptographic Item (CCI), and vehicle parts supporting depot and integration activities. Collaborate with United States (US) Army and US Marines Corp for the movement of MRAPs between depot and integration facilities. Review LTI workbooks submitted by field units for accuracy and completeness prior to requesting movement funds and finalizing the required movement actions. Assist in the development of a Support Agreement between US Army TACOM andACC/A4R MRAP WST
to ensure all AF MRAP Common Remotely Operated Weapon Station (CROWS) assigned to CONUS and OCONUS locations are properly serviced with the latest software updates and maintained in a fully mission capable (FMC) status. Develop fleet- wide movement status reports and distribute to MAJCOM and HAF leadership as required. Assist with command level logistics management and analysis planning for the Air Force MRAP program.
